Добавление: Откат на PHP 5.6 не помог.
18.01.2017 19:43:30
Пару лет назад пытался подружить 10 версию сайта медицинской организации и 1С:Медицина. Поликлиника 1.3 – обмен на сайт шел, но были ограничения со стороны 1С и решение не запустили.
В этом году перешли на 1С:Медицина. Поликлиника 1.4 да и сайт медицинской организации вроде-как допилен. Скачал BitrixVM 7.0.0, на ней развернул дело версию "1С-Битрикс: Управление сайтом 16.5.4" в редакции "Бизнес", установил из Marketplace решение 1С-Битрикс: Сайт медицинской организации последней версии (5.0.3 от 28.12.2016) Все прошло прекрасно – сайт поднялся, все работает. Выгружаю из 1С данные в формате MedML согласно инструкции, проверяю их – вся структура соответствует руководству по MedML идущему с решением. Вот сами данные – Но при попытке импортировать данные на сайт – зависание, просто индикатор загрузки крутиться и все – Пробовал и из-под Windows (IE, Firefox) и под Mac OS X (Safari, Firefox) – разницы нет, загрузка не идет. Сайт добавлен в безопасную зону, Java плагины разрешены. В журнале чисто (Инструменты / Журнал событий) В журале обмена с МИС (Интеграция с МИС / Журнал работы с МИС) единственная запись "21:19:32 > Import to files started" На сайте установлено PHP Version 7.0.14, имеет-ли смысл сделать откат на старую версию? Почему не идет обмен и где можно посмотреть логи или ход процесса импорта? Сам файл в папку обмена сайт загружает прекрасно. Не хочется второй раз покупать лицензию за 100К если опять ничего толком не работает. Могу предоставить образ BitrixVM |
|
|
10.07.2015 21:38:48
Ну право слово.... Вы меня просто обижаете.... Сейчас специально повторил весть процесс с фото Но т.к. у вас на форуме до сих пор прошлый век (Ай-яй-яй!!! И это разработчик ведущей Web-платформы....) и нельзя даже скриншот без внешнего хостинга приложить напишу словами: 1. Качаем BitrixVM 5.1.3 b запускаем на VMWare Fusion 11, предварительно добавив памяти до 4096Mb, настроив виртуальный сетевой адаптер, расширенные папик, буферизацию диска в гипервизоре и увеличиваем диск ВМ до 24Gb 2. Стартуем ВМ из-под Yosemite 10.10.4, после старта меняем пароль root на BTX51VMT и пароль пользователя "bitrix" на "bitrix" 3. В оснастке управления создаем хост "bx_srv2", обновляем BitrixENV до актуального состояния, выходим в консоль. Далее yum -y update; после reboot 4. Из ОС гипервизора через Yummy FTP заходим по IP-адресу ВМ от имени пользователя "bitrix" 5. В папке /home/bitrix/www удаляем все и заливаем туда распакованный дистрибутив (из zip) - а именно "Сайт медицинской организации 14.0" 6. Reboot 7. Заходим на сервер и начинаем установку.... ах да! забыли права проверить - хорошо ls -l /home/bitrix/www все нормально с правами... хотя надежды были... Теперь точно заходим и начинаем установку. После подписи согласий, ввода лицензий, попадаем на меню установки: Сервер: localhost (если что locahost:31006 не пашет) Пользователь базы данных: существующий ("bitrix") Пароль: пустая строка БД: новая ("bx_db4") Тип таблиц: InnoDB Логин админа БД: "root" c пустым паролем Права на доступ к файлам сайта: по умолчанию (0644) Права на доступ к папкам сайта: по умолчанию (0755) Все прекрасно устанавливается, после перезагрузки сайт не стартует. В оснастке при выборе "показать сайты с ошибками" - уведомление о невозможности сайта подключиться к БД Внимание!!! ВОПРОС - ЧТО Я ОПЯТЬ НЕ ТАК СДЕЛАЛ? Скриншоты процесса могу прислать. |
|
|
09.07.2015 19:28:29
Уважаемая техподдержка и администрация!
Напишите наконец инструкцию "для чайников" как развернуть сайт на BitrixVM руками и без автоматической загрузки. Это же бред - на OpenServer встает, на Denver встает - на РОДНОЙ!!! BitrixVM просто секс с извращениями. Итак задача: установить для тестирования связи с 1С решение "Сайт медицинской организации" (ну или любое другое) Условие №1: лицензия просрочена (или нет инета или любая другая причина которая вздумается) Условие №2: в наличии есть ОФИЦИАЛЬНЫЙ ЛЕГАЛЬНЫЙ полученный законным способом от Битрикса дистрибутив сайта. Проблема №1: Руководство по установке легально купленного решения после окончания лицензии на текущий момент очень скудное (привожу сюда как ответ техподдержки так и ссылку на решение): _________________ Ответ клиентской поддержки: Добрый день! Пожалуйста, вот ссылка на дистрибутив: здесь была ссылка на архив дистрибутива. Так как ключ не активен, то для установки продукта Вам необходимо ориентироваться вот на этот способ: _________________ А вот и сам Чудо-Способ: ____________________________________________________________ Продукт «1С-Битрикс» поставляется в виде архивов .zip и .tar.gz для версий PHP 5.
Для успешной установки и функционирования продукта серверное программное обеспечение должно удовлетворять минимальным техническим требованиям продукта:
Мой путь: Попытка №1: - ставим Windows 2012 Server + MySQL + PHP 5.6 + IIS - сайт развернуть смогли, умерли в тем что "папка сессий PHP не доступна для записи" при разворачивании сайта, не лечиться. Попытка №2: - ставим Windows 2012 Server + MSSQL2014 + PHP 5.6 + IIS - установку сайта развернуть смогли, умерли на том, что "папка сессий PHP не доступна для записи" при разворачивании сайта, тоже не лечиться. Попытка №3: ставим BitrixVM 5.1.3, штатными средствами панели удаляем нафиг сайт по умолчанию, создаем ШТАТНЫМИ СРЕДСТВАМИ ОСНАСТКИ новый сайт в режиме kernel - получаем там базу, и bitrrixsetup.php, не понял что с этим делать. Закинул дистрибутив сайта в папку /bitrix/home/www. Зашли на установку сайта - опять умерли на том, что "папка сессий PHP не доступна для записи" при разворачивании сайта, тоже не лечиться. Попытка №4: берем чистую BitrixVM 5.1.3, меняем только пароли по умолчанию. Заходим по SFTP, удаляем из папки /bitrix/home/www все что там есть. Заливаем туда ОФИЦИАЛЬНЫЙ дистрибутив сайта из присланного Битриксом zip-архива. Ура! Установка сайта запустилась, и мы уже прошли проклятую точку с session.save_path !!! Но... что это??? Теперь не хочет работать MySQL... Не беда - через консоль даем root новый пароль. Все равно не получилось - по крайней мере если пользователь базы "bitrix".... Ладно пусть он будет "root" - ОК! сайт установился, база создалась, уже даже надежда появилась... Но... НЕТ!!! Сайт не доступен.... ЗАНАВЕС! Я не претендую на проф. уровень администрирования CentOS и так далее. Да в общем и не мое это (я врач в конце-концов) Но не уже так сложно внятно написать инструкцию по установке? НА ТЕКУЩИЙ МОМЕНТ У МЕНЯ СОЗДАЕТСЯ ВПЕЧАТЛЕНИЕ ЧТО ОТНОШЕНИЕ К ПОЛЬЗОВАТЕЛЯМ, НЕ ПРОДЛИВШИМ ПОДПИСКУ НЕ КАК К КЛИЕНТАМ, А КАК К ЛОХАМ!!! Хочу напомнить всем - я купил продукт и имею право на его использование. Я так же имею право получить ПОСЛЕДНЮЮ актуальную на момент окончания мое подписки версию продукта. Я не претендую на премиум-уровень поддержки, но деньги я все-же заплатил, и по крайней мере на минимальное уважение от компании могу рассчитывать. Так как мне установить легально присланный вами дистрибутив на ваш-же бесплатный продукт который вы продвигаете как решение для обычного пользователя??? Дайте хоть ссылку на вменяемое руководство! Что хочется - в идеале чтобы вы добавили в раздел консоли "Create site" простенький пункт для развертывания "из ZIP-архива купленного дистрибутива" Хочу отметить прекрасную работу менеджеров клиентской поддержки - все присылают, не отказывают даже при просроченной подписке, вежливо общаются! Но инструкция тех поддержки - я разместил 4 раза разными способами на разных машинах дистрибутив именно в корневой папке сайта и ничего. Может имеет смысл уточнить еще какие-то нюансы? Или честно написать - что после окончания подписки с нашим дистрибутивом нужны долгие пляски с бубном с неясным итогом. Особенно доставляет что на бесплатную сборку OpenServer на Windows все встает с пол-пинка. Заранее спасибо если решите ответить! |
|
|